Wouldn't say out of nowhere as he could have easily slipped into the first round of the 2008 draft (he was 8th on the international list for central scouting). As it stands he was taken at #32. He has steadily improved every year since coming to North America....29 pts his first AHL season, 51 his next, split time between AHL and NHL the next (20 pts in 54 games in the NHL last year as a rookie), and this year really began to establish himself as a top 4 guy. He was second in icetime behind Doughty I believe.
